## Ownership

ParityScope is our little rate-parity checker that crawls partner hotel listings and flags when our published rates drift from the contracted ones. It's mostly cron jobs plus a diffing service, so when it breaks it usually breaks quietly — watch the freshness dashboard. Config lives in `parity.yaml`; don't hand-edit prod values without a PR. Questions, pages, and angry Slack messages about stale comparisons all go to the maintainer listed below.

named custodian: Brivan Eliath Quenox Frador

## Webhook Retry Semantics — Pushgate

Pushgate retries failed deliveries with exponential backoff, capped at six attempts. A 410 response removes the endpoint permanently; all other 4xx codes skip retries but keep the subscription. Duplicate delivery is possible — consumers must be idempotent. Before promoting a release, confirm the retry worker is running with these values:

service settings:
quenath:
  log_level: info
  metrics_host: metrics.quenath.tolvaqlabs.internal
  pin: 1407
  pool_size: 8

**Vendor note: Inkmill markdown pipeline**

Rendering for Parchway docs is outsourced to Inkmill under an annual contract, renewing each March. They handle sanitization and PDF export; we own the upload queue. SLA: 4-hour response on rendering failures. Escalate only after two failed retries. Their support desk is reachable at the address below.

billing contact of hahaf-baguf = zorael.tammir.jorius@sivrelhq.internal